[发明专利]语音识别方法和装置有效
申请号: | 201610795918.9 | 申请日: | 2016-08-31 |
公开(公告)号: | CN106328147B | 公开(公告)日: | 2022-02-01 |
发明(设计)人: | 高建清;陈恩红;王智国;胡国平;胡郁;刘庆峰 | 申请(专利权)人: | 中国科学技术大学;科大讯飞股份有限公司 |
主分类号: | G10L15/26 | 分类号: | G10L15/26;G10L15/197;G10L15/18 |
代理公司: | 北京集佳知识产权代理有限公司 11227 | 代理人: | 王宝筠 |
地址: | 230026 安*** | 国省代码: | 安徽;34 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 语音 识别 方法 装置 | ||
本发明公开一种语音识别方法和装置。所述方法包括:获取与待识别语音数据相关的基础资料;确定所述基础资料的关键词;依据所述关键词确定搜索项,通过所述搜索项搜索目标语料;通过所述目标语料训练目标主题语言模型,以所述目标主题语言模型识别所述待识别语音数据。应用本发明提供的技术方案,能够提高识别特定应用场景的语音数据的准确度,识别效果较好。
技术领域
本发明涉及自然语言处理技术领域,尤其涉及一种语音识别方法和装置。
背景技术
语音识别是将语音转成文本的过程,近年来,随着语音识别技术的成熟,该技术已逐渐成功应用于各行各业中,尤其是针对特定领域的语音识别技术,如针对会议的录音数据进行语音识别,将接收的语音数据直接转换为会议的文本内容,大大方便了会议秘书整理会议纪要。
目前的技术中,一般直接采用通用的声学模型及通用语言模型对待识别语音数据进行语音识别,针对特定应用场景的语音数据进行语音识别时,由于经常会存在专业词汇、特定用法导致无法正确识别的问题,仅仅依靠通用语言模型往往无法满足应用需求,因此往往采用语言模型定制的方式,即预先获取用户提供的大量与该特定应用场景相关的语料后,训练相应的主题语言模型,利用该主题语言模型、通用的声学模型及通用语言模型进行语音识别。
然而,在实际应用中,往往仅知道少量应用场景信息,无法通过用户直接获取到足够数量的主题相关的语料以训练主题相关语言模型,导致语音识别的准确度比较低,识别效果较差,如待识别语音数据为会议录音时,往往仅知道会议相关的演示文稿,数据量较少,不足以训练相应的主题语言模型,导致语音识别效果较差。
发明内容
有鉴于此,本发明提供了一种语音识别方法和装置,能够提高识别特定应用场景的语音数据的准确度,识别效果较好。
为实现上述目的,本发明提供如下技术方案:
第一方面,本发明实施例提供了一种语音识别方法,包括:
获取与待识别语音数据相关的基础资料;
确定所述基础资料的关键词;
依据所述关键词确定搜索项,通过所述搜索项搜索目标语料;
通过所述目标语料训练目标主题语言模型,以所述目标主题语言模型识别所述待识别语音数据。
可选的,所述确定所述基础资料的关键词,包括:
以第一确定方式确定所述关键词,所述第一确定方式包括,依据预先训练得到的编码-解码模型计算所述基础资料中每个词作为所述关键词的概率,将所述概率大于第一预设阈值的词确定为所述关键词;
或者以第二确定方式确定所述关键词,所述第二确定方式包括,计算所述基础资料中每个词的词频和逆文档频率,将所述词频大于第二预设阈值且所述逆文档频率大于第三预设阈值的词确定所述关键词;
或者以第三确定方式确定所述关键词,所述第三确定方式包括,计算所述基础资料中每个词的TextRank得分,将所述TextRank得分大于第四预设阈值的词作为所述关键词;
或者所述第一确定方式、所述第二确定方式和所述第三确定方式中,以任意两种方式或三种方式相结合来确定候选关键词,将经过去重后的所述候选关键词作为所述关键词。
可选的,所述依据所述关键词确定搜索项,通过所述搜索项搜索目标语料,包括:
统计所述基础资料的每个句子中包含的所述关键词个数,将包含至少两个关键词的句子中的所有关键词作为一个关键词组,将不属于任一所述关键词组的所述关键词作为独立关键词;
依据所述关键词组和所述独立关键词确定所述搜索项,通过所述搜索项搜索所述目标语料。
可选的,还包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国科学技术大学;科大讯飞股份有限公司,未经中国科学技术大学;科大讯飞股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201610795918.9/2.html,转载请声明来源钻瓜专利网。
- 上一篇:基于故障注入的芯片安全测试方法及系统
- 下一篇:数据查询方法和装置